This product can help improve hydration of the skin with the two types of ingredients.
The first type is called “humectants”:
these ingredients help attract water.
When humectants are on the surface of the skin, they “pull in” the moisture from the outside environment, or from
within deeper layers of the skin. The following ingredients in this product do the job:
glycerin, inositol.
This product also contains ingredients called “occlusives”. They help reduce the speed with which our skin loses moisture to the outside environment. These ingredients also help soften the upper layer of the skin, so it feels less tight and nicer to the touch. The following ingredients in this product do the job: cholesterol, c12-15 alkyl benzoate.

A stable derivative of vitamin C. It is oil-soluble which means it is more likely to penetrate the skin compared to the pure form of vitamin C (which is water-soluble), but it is less bio-available and is way less effective in stimulating collagen and reducing wrinkles compared to the pure form of vitamin C (L-ascorbic acid) and its other derivatives (for example, magnesium ascorbyl phosphate). At the same time, this vitamin C derivative has been shown in studies to be effective in reducing acne, blemishes and clogged pores. It is less irritating then the pure form of vitamin C
